.prolink-header {
	display: none !important;
}
#prolinkhdr {
	display: none !important;
}
#adblock-clip {
	display: none !important;
}
#adblock-rightside {
	display: none !important;
}
#page-navigation {
	display: none !important;
}
#page-promo {
	display: none !important;
}
#rss-hub {
	display: none !important;
}
#page-column-right {
	display: none !important;
}
#social-plugins {
	display: none !important;
}
#article-society {
	display: none !important;
}
#page-footer .navigation {
	display: none !important;
}
#page-footer .mf-link-right {
	display: none !important;
}
.noprint {
	display: none !important;
}
.video {
	display: none !important;
}
.YOUTUBE_CLIP {
	display: none !important;
}
.fb_iframe_widget {
	display: none !important;
}
.button-row {
	display: none !important;
}
.advertisement {
	display: none !important;
}
.box-hcv {
	display: none !important;
}
#prolinkftr {
	display: none !important;
}
#page-footer {
	display: none !important;
}
#article-list-float-clip {
	display: none !important;
}
table {
	padding-right: 0px !important; page-break-inside: avoid;
}
p {
	padding-right: 0px !important; page-break-inside: avoid;
}
ul {
	padding-right: 0px !important; page-break-inside: avoid;
}
h1 {
	padding-right: 0px !important; page-break-inside: avoid;
}
h2 {
	padding-right: 0px !important; page-break-inside: avoid;
}
h3 {
	padding-right: 0px !important; page-break-inside: avoid;
}
h4 {
	padding-right: 0px !important; page-break-inside: avoid;
}
h6 {
	padding-right: 0px !important; page-break-inside: avoid;
}
h1 {
	page-break-after: avoid;
}
h2 {
	page-break-after: avoid;
}
h3 {
	page-break-after: avoid;
}
#logo-img {
	padding-left: 12px; display: none !important;
}
body {
	background: 0px 0px rgb(255, 255, 255); text-align: left; color: rgb(0, 0, 0); line-height: 1.7em; font-family: Georgia,"Times New Roman",Times,serif; font-size: 0.8em; font-weight: 200;
}
#page-column-left {
	width: 100%; float: none;
}
#page-logo {
	display: none !important;
}
#page-data-main-clip {
	width: 100%; overflow: auto; clear: none; min-width: 100%;
}
#page-data {
	width: 100%; overflow: auto; clear: none; min-width: 100%;
}
h1 {
	font-family: Arial, sans-serif !important;
}
h2 {
	font-family: Arial, sans-serif !important;
}
h3 {
	font-family: Arial, sans-serif !important;
}
h4 {
	font-family: Arial, sans-serif !important;
}
h5 {
	font-family: Arial, sans-serif !important;
}
h6 {
	font-family: Arial, sans-serif !important;
}
code {
	font: 0.9em/normal "Courier New", Monaco, Courier, monospace; font-size-adjust: none; font-stretch: normal;
}
h1 {
	line-height: 1.7em; font-size: 2.5em;
}
a img {
	border: currentColor; border-image: none;
}
blockquote {
	margin: 1.5em; padding: 1em; font-size: 0.9em; font-style: italic;
}
a:link {
	background: none; font-weight: 700; text-decoration: underline;
}
a:visited {
	background: none; font-weight: 700; text-decoration: underline;
}
.article-tags {
	display: none;
}
.article-tags .article-date {
	color: rgb(0, 0, 0) !important;
}
.article-macro-table {
	border: 3px solid rgb(192, 192, 192); border-image: none; margin-bottom: 1em; border-collapse: collapse;
}
.article-macro-table td {
	padding: 2px 4px; border: 1px solid rgb(192, 192, 192); border-image: none; font-family: Arial, sans-serif !important; font-size: 0.8em;
}
.article-macro-table th {
	padding: 2px 4px; border: 1px solid rgb(192, 192, 192); border-image: none; font-family: Arial, sans-serif !important; font-size: 0.8em;
}
